Can you please describe in more detail what happens when you try to update plugins?
The appearance of my WordPress when i try to update themes etc. is like the attached screenshot
This looks like a server-side error. Are you accessing the backend via https? If not, do that and try again.
Otherwise, I would recommend you to contact the support of your hoster.
I previously installed an https security header plugin, but I can’t recall its name since I removed it some time ago. Do you have any other suggestions considering I genuinely forgot the plugin’s name, :[
The only thing that comes to mind is Really Simple SSL:
If this has left any residue in your hosting, a look at the .htaccess file might be useful. The support of your hoster can also help you with this.
